resharper

    2热度

    1回答

    是否有一些Visual Studio扩展,检查潜在线程不安全的代码并标记这段代码?也许ReSharper有这种能力?

    1热度

    1回答

    我正在使用Visual Studio 2017和Resharper 17.1.3。我的同事们正在使用相同的版本。出于某种原因,我必须重新安装resharper,并注意到单元测试选项丢失。我卸载并重新安装,但仍然缺失。当我使用快捷方式(ctr + U,ctr + I)时,我收到Resharper_UnitTestRunSolution目前不可用的通知。 有关如何解决它的任何想法? 感谢,

    3热度

    2回答

    我创建了一个类我的项目的子文件夹中,并命名空间不匹配匹配的文件夹结构。 ReSharper的强调了命名空间和,一边看着提出解决问题的选项ReSharper的,不小心选择了“文件夹不产生命名空间”的选项。该设置在哪里存储?我想撤消选择,以便ReSharper的强制命名/目录中的奇偶,至少该文件夹。 我检查了.sln,然后是.csproj文件,以及有问题的目录中可能包含信息的任何松散文件,并且无法找到

    0热度

    1回答

    我遇到了一些单元测试是针对异步方法编写的问题。这些方法返回Task<t>,我发现一个测试返回值是否为空。相反,测试应测试任务的返回值是否为空。将方法从同步返回t更改为异步时,这也是一个问题,返回Task<t>。当单元测试针对任务进行测试时,有什么方法可以显示警告吗?我正在使用NUnit,FluentAssertions和ReSharper。当然,首选是代码库中的内容,并且可以与团队的其他成员共享(

    2热度

    1回答

    在C#中使用Resharper很长时间后,我现在在Java领域使用IntelliJ。偶尔我发现Value Origin/Destination的Resharper功能确实有用。 IntelliJ中是否有等价物?我似乎无法找到它。 对于不熟悉Resharper功能的用户,它使您能够跟踪变量/字段值的源/目标层次结构。因此,您可以跟踪调用堆栈中参数值的来源,从其他变量复制,从函数返回值等。或者类似地跟

    1热度

    1回答

    我有一组类文件(近1500个文件)。我的任务是确定项目/解决方案中课程的用途。我可以通过使用CTRL + F12来浏览一个文件,但我无法完成所有操作。 我们有这样的自动/半自动方式吗? 请注意,我用的ReSharper的(2016年3月2日)和2015年VS

    4热度

    1回答

    我试图使用新的C#7的模式匹配功能,在这行代码 if (Customers.SingleOrDefault(x => x.Type == CustomerType.Company) is Customer customer) { ... } 但对于一些原因ReSharper的/ Visual Studio的2017年是给我一个警告is Customer下,出现以下消息 源表达模式

    7热度

    2回答

    我有一个扩展方法: public static bool Exists(this object toCheck) { return toCheck != null; } 如果我使用它,然后做这样的事情: if (duplicate.Exists()) throw new Exception(duplicate); 然后ReSharper的警告我说,有一个可能的空引用

    4热度

    1回答

    [HttpPost] public async Task<IActionResult> Upload(string memberNumber, IFormFile file) { var uploadsFolderPath = Path.Combine(_host.WebRootPath, "uploads"); var fileName = Guid

    0热度

    1回答

    好吧,我希望这是一个简单的。我创建了一个用于快速创建视图模型的简单模板,并将为匹配视图开发另一个模板。 我只需要从宏中得到两个正确工作的变量。 首先是类名,这与文件名相同作为例子。 MyPageViewModel 我可以得到这个工作正常。 我在我的视图模型中有第二个名为PageName的变量。这与文件名非常相似,只有在ViewModel也被剪掉的情况下。 有没有办法在resharper活模板中做到